How To Fix FINCS_USEL011 - You are not authorized to display selections for selection class &1.


FINCS_USEL011 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FINCS_USEL - Message Class of Unified Selection

  • Message number: 011

  • Message text: You are not authorized to display selections for selection class &1.

    The SAP error message FINCS_USEL011 indicates that a user is not authorized to display selections for a specific selection class. This typically occurs in the context of financial applications within SAP, where users need specific authorizations to access certain data or functionalities.
    
    Cause: The error is caused by a lack of authorization for the user to view or access the selections related to the specified selection class (denoted by &1). This can happen due to: Missing Authorization Object: The user’s role may not include the necessary authorization object that grants access to the selection class.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not be configured correctly to include the required permissions. User Profile Issues: The user profile may not be updated with the latest roles or authorizations.
